Boozman presses fresh farm-bill vote as SNAP disputes and AI bets reshape Capitol week

TL;DR Summary

Senate Agriculture Chair John Boozman plans another committee vote on his GOP farm bill next week to push farm-friendly provisions despite Democrats’ opposition to SNAP cuts and the absence of Sen. Mitch McConnell; Democrats want a two-year delay for the SNAP cost-share requirement, Boozman counters with a one-year delay. The digest also flagships House GOP leader Tom Emmer’s stance on term-limit waivers, Hawley’s call for more detail on OpenAI’s Hugging Face cyberattack, Cruz’s push for AI regulation, a data-center moratorium ad in Rep. Brian Fitzpatrick’s race, and Donald Trump’s pledge to send $5,000 checks if Republicans hold Congress.
